Function and Role of ā£the Temperature Cold Control Thermostat in Refrigerator temperature Regulation
The 240383703 Frigidaire Refrigerator⢠Temperature ā£Cold Control āThermostat is a temperature-actuated switch that controls compressor cycling to maintain the desired refrigerator temperature. It senses temperature āwith a probe⤠or capillary sensing element and operatesā an internal contact that energizes or de-energizes theā compressor circuit based on the selected setpoint. The control establishes a setpoint āand built-in hysteresisā (deadband) so the compressor runs long enough to removeā heat⢠but not so often that the system short-cycles; this behavior determines duty cycle, ambient load⤠handlingand steady-state temperature. Verify the part ānumber, mounting style,ā connector typeand electrical rating against the āappliance wiring harness before replacing the unitā to ā¤ensure compatibility with theā specific Frigidaire model and electrical system.
- Primary āfunctions: setpoint adjustment, sensing āelement,⣠and compressor switching.
- Behavioralā characteristics: hysteresis (deadband), mechanical or gas-filled sensing responseand cycle timing.
- Common symptoms⤠of⤠failure: continuous run, failure to ā£startor erratic/short cycling.
- Service considerations: ācorrectā probe placement āand matching electrical rating and connector style.
In theā field, techniciansā diagnose thermostat issues by ā¢observing cycle patterns and verifying continuity across ā¤the control at different ā£temperatures; lack of change āin ā¤contact state ā¤when the temperature crosses expected thresholds indicates a faulty thermostat or a sensor/connection⤠fault. Practicalā examples: advancing the thermostat to a colder settingā should increaseā compressor run-time and lower compartment temperature, ā£while a mispositioned bulb that does not contact the⣠evaporator ā¤can ā£cause prolonged run times ā¤or temperature instability. When replacing the control,match the⤠electrical ā¤rating and mounting orientation,confirm the sensing element has ā£solid thermal contact with the ā¢evaporator or airstream,and rule out refrigerant charge,fans,or ā£defrost⤠faults⤠that ācan āmimic thermostatā failure.

Common Failure āSymptoms āand Diagnostic Tests āforā temperature Cold Controlā Thermostat Faults
The ā 240383703 Frigidaire ā£Refrigerator Temperature cold Control Thermostat ⣠is a⢠userāset temperature control that closes and opens an internal⢠switch to command the compressor and sometimes the āevaporator āfan. In mechanical versions this is a⣠bimetal⤠switch; in electronic variants it can be a sensor plus switching module. Functionally the ācontrol does not adjust refrigerant ā¤charge or defrost timing – it simply calls for cooling based on āsensed āair temperature and the selected setpoint. Compatibility āconsiderations include terminal labeling and control voltage (typically line ā¤voltage ā¤for the switch⢠contacts); a direct replacement must matchā the original ā¢wiring layout and the⣠same control type (mechanical switch āvs thermistor/board) toā behave correctly in the system. Practical examples: āa thermostat that has welded contacts āwill leave the compressor running continuously and ā¤over-freeze the evaporator, while an open contact ā£will āprevent the compressor from āstarting and⢠allow temperatures to rise⢠in bothā fridge and freezer compartments.
- Symptom: Refrigerator is⣠warm and ācompressor⣠does not ā¢start – Diagnostic: verify powerā to the āappliance, then check for continuity⢠across the thermostat terminals ā¢at a cold āsetpoint; anā open circuit when the control is calling ā¢for cooling indicates a failed switch.
- Symptom: ā¢Compressor runs continuously or freezer overcools – Diagnostic: check for⣠continuity⤠at a warm setpoint and inspect for stuck/shorted ācontacts or shortedā sensor element.
- Symptom: rapid short cycling ā£or āinconsistent temperatureā swingsā – Diagnostic: measure the on/off differential with āa thermocouple āor data logger and ā¤compare against expected hysteresis; inspect mechanicalā linkage and damper operation for⢠interaction issues.
- Symptom: Intermittent āoperation or ā£audible clicking – Diagnostic: probe wiring harness and ā¢connectors for corrosionand perform voltage checks at the thermostat terminals during⣠aā call for cooling to determine if the control or⢠external relay/board is failing.
Diagnostic tests⢠are straightforward for āa ā£technician withā a multimeter: with power removed,confirm connector⢠pinout and continuity ā£characteristics (closed contacts ā 0 Ī©,open ā infinite). With power applied and the unit set to callā for cooling,measure AC āvoltageā at the⣠thermostat⤠output terminal to ādetermine āwhether the control is sending line voltage to the compressor contactor or relay. For sensorābased controls verify ā¤resistance againstā temperature reference valuesā or use ā¤an iceāwater bath ā£to simulate a cold condition; be ā¢aware thatā thermistorātype elementsā have ā¤a characteristic resistanceā curve (for example ~10 kĪ© at 25 °C ā¤for many ā¤NTC sensors) whereas mechanical switchesā are āsimpleā open/closed devices. Always compare measured⤠behavior to āthe original part’s ā£specification and the ā¢fridgeā model’s ā¢wiring diagram before replacing the control.

Q&A
What is the 240383703 Frigidaire Refrigerator Temperature Cold Control Thermostat?
The 240383703 ā£is a replacement ātemperature (cold)⢠control thermostat usedā on many Frigidaire refrigerators. It isā a mechanical temperature switch that senses ā£cabinetā temperature⢠and opens āor closesā the compressor ā¤power circuit to maintain the set temperature. āIt⣠is commonly referred to ā¢as the cold control or ā¢mechanical thermostat knobā assembly.
How ādo I know if this thermostat is the cause of my ārefrigerator running too cold or too ā¤warm?
Common symptoms of a⣠failing coldā control ā¢include the compressor running continuously (fridge ā£too cold), the compressor ānever running (fridge too warm)or temperature ā£changing when you turn the thermostat knob āwith no effect on cooling. Before replacingā the thermostat, checkā for āother ā¢causes such⤠as a stuck/failed ā£evaporator fan, iced-over evaporator ā(defrost ā¤failure), a bad compressor start relay or overloadand doorā seals. If those⣠systems check out and ā¢the thermostat behaves erratically or doesn’t change the compressor operation when ā¢turned, ā¤the thermostat is a likely ācause.
How can I test the 240383703 thermostat to⤠confirm it ā£is bad?
Unplug the refrigerator āand access ā£the thermostat wiring (usually ā£behind the control housing). With a multimeter set to continuity āor ohms, disconnect the⣠thermostat wires and check for ā¢continuity between the compressor-related terminals while rotating ā¤the temperature⣠knob. When the thermostat is turned to ā¢a colder setting (calling⣠for ācool) the circuit that āfeeds the ā¤compressor should close ā¢(show continuity);⤠when turnedā toward warm it should open (no continuity). You can also check that the switch responds to a small ā¤temperature change (blowing warm or cool air on the sensor). if the switch⢠does⣠not ā¤change state appropriately, it is indeed⤠faulty. Always removeā power before disconnecting wires.
How do I⣠replace the⢠240383703 thermostat – is it a difficultā DIY⣠job?
Replacement is ā¢generally straightforward for a ā¤mechanically skilled DIYer: unplug the appliance,ā remove the control knob and⢠the control housing or bezel to expose the āthermostat, document/photograph wire positions, disconnect⢠the wires,ā remove mounting screwsand swap in the ā£new thermostat. Reconnect wires exactly as they were, reassemble the housing,ā plug in the⢠refrigerator, āand test āoperation. Typical tools: ā¢screwdriver, nut driver, needle-nose pliersand a multimeter. Estimated time is ā¤15-45 minutes.ā if⤠you are uncomfortable ā£workingā with appliance āwiring or unsure of compatibility,⣠hire a qualified technician.
Is the 240383703 adjustableā orā calibratable if my ā¢refrigerator temperature is off?
The thermostat is ā¢adjusted by the user knob which ā¤selects a setpoint; there isā no ā¢internal user calibration. If the refrigerator’s⤠actual temperature consistently differs from the knobā setting, itā might potentially be replacing the thermostat⣠or verifying other systems (air ā£flow, door seals, thermostat sensing location).Some technicians can fine-tune indexing or replace withā a thermostat⢠having a slightly different range, ābut typical ā¢consumer adjustment isā limited to ā¢the knobā setting.
How do I verify compatibility with my ā£Frigidaire modelā before ā¢ordering part 240383703?
Locate the refrigerator modelā and serial number⢠(usually on a ā¤sticker inside the fresh food compartment ā¢or ābehind a grille). Cross-reference that modelā number with the part number in ā¢the official Frigidaire/Electrolux parts lookup, the retailer’s parts ā¢compatibility toolor⣠the refrigerator’s parts diagram. Many⤠aftermarket sellers list compatible ā¢models. If in doubt, provideā the model number⢠to the parts supplier or service centre to confirm the 240383703 is ā£correctā for your unit.
What ā¤other refrigerator components can mimic āa failing thermostat,⤠andā how do I rule ā£them out?
Components that can produce similar symptoms include a failed compressor start relay/overload ā(compressor won’t start), a bad evap āfan (poor ā¢cold ā£distribution), a blocked/iced evaporator ā¤(no or poor cooling⣠despite ācompressor running), a defective thermistor or electronic control (on digital models)and⣠poor door seals or excessive frost build-up. Diagnose by listeningā for the ā¢compressorā and fans,ā checking evaporator defrost state, testing the start⤠relayand performing the⣠thermostat⣠continuity test. Replaceā only the failed component identified āby ā¢testing.
